How do you ensure that the product backlog is kept up-to-date and accurately reflects the current priorities?

A more solid answer
To ensure that the product backlog is kept up-to-date and accurately reflects the current priorities, I would employ a strategic approach. First, I would regularly communicate with stakeholders, including educators and learners, to understand their needs and expectations. This would involve conducting surveys, organizing focus groups, and analyzing user feedback. Additionally, I would conduct market research to identify emerging trends in the educational market, such as new teaching methodologies or technologies. This information would be used to prioritize features in the backlog, ensuring that our products remain relevant and competitive. As a product manager, I would collaborate closely with the engineering team to evaluate the feasibility and effort required for each feature. This partnership would allow us to effectively prioritize and plan sprints to address the highest-priority items. Lastly, I would regularly review and update the backlog based on feedback from users, stakeholders, and market insights. By continuously iterating and refining the backlog, we can ensure that it aligns with our product vision and goals.

An exceptional answer
As a product manager, I understand the critical role of an up-to-date and accurate product backlog in driving successful product development. To achieve this, I would employ a multifaceted approach. Firstly, I would establish regular channels of communication with stakeholders, such as educators, learners, and other relevant team members. This would include conducting workshops, holding weekly sync meetings, and using collaboration tools to gather feedback and insights. By actively involving stakeholders in the backlog management process, we can ensure that their needs and priorities are well-represented. Secondly, I would conduct comprehensive market research to identify not only current educational trends, but also anticipate future demands. This would involve analyzing industry reports, attending conferences, and engaging with industry experts. By staying ahead of market trends, we can proactively incorporate innovative features and functionalities into the backlog. Additionally, I would leverage data analytics to assess the performance and engagement of the product. This would enable me to make data-driven decisions when prioritizing features and continuously optimizing the backlog. Furthermore, I would foster a collaborative environment by facilitating cross-functional workshops and brainstorming sessions. This would encourage a diverse range of ideas and perspectives, leading to more robust discussions and better prioritization of backlog items. Finally, I would regularly review and refine the backlog based on feedback from users and stakeholders, ensuring that it remains aligned with the product vision and goals. By following these strategies, I believe I can effectively keep the product backlog up-to-date and accurately reflect the current priorities.

How to prepare for this question
- Familiarize yourself with agile development methodologies and product management tools, as these will be crucial in managing the product backlog.
- Research the educational market and stay updated on current trends and challenges in the industry. This will help you identify relevant features and priorities for the backlog.
- Practice gathering and analyzing feedback from stakeholders. Focus on active listening and asking probing questions to better understand their needs and expectations.
- Develop your problem-solving skills by tackling real-world product management challenges. This could involve identifying and resolving conflicts between competing priorities or finding creative solutions to resource constraints.
